PRAYER: Writ Petition filed under Article 226 of Constitution of India praying to issue a Writ of Mandamus by way of directing the respondents to implement the G.O.Ms.No.155 dated 9.3.2015 passed by the first respondent and accordingly all the petitioners have to bring into time scale of pay with arrears. O R D E R
The 1st and 2nd petitioners herein are temporary employees working as "Water tank Operators" in the Coimbatore Corporation. In so far as the 1st petitioner is concerned, the learned Standing Counsel for the Corporation would submit that as per G.O.Ms.No117, the Corporation Counsel has taken a decision to regularise the services of the petitioner and accordingly a proposal has been sent on 01.02.2021 and it has been forwarded to the Government which is pending. In so far as the 2nd petitioner is concerned, the learned Standing Counsel would submit that after 2017, the 2nd petitioner had abandoned his services and has not reported for duty till date.
2. In the light of the submissions made by the learned Standing Counsel, the Coimbatore Corporation shall endeavour to follow up the proposal sent by them to the Government and pass appropriate orders to bring the 1st petitioner under regular time
scale of pay in accordance with the approval to be granted by the Government. The 2nd petitioner, since had abandoned his services from 2017 onwards, will not be entitled for regularization or any service benefits.
3. In so far as the 3rd and 4th petitioners are concerned, the Government in G.O.Ms.No.60 dated 23.06.2006 as well as G.O.Ms.No.155 dated 09.03.2015 had ordered for regularization of the employees who are similarly placed that of the petitioners 3, 4 and 5 herein and were brought under regular time scale of pay with effect from 23.06.2006 onwards, in the post of "Sweeper".
4. In so far as the 5th petitioner is concerned, it is stated by the learned Government Advocate that he had given his willingness to be absorbed as a "Sweeper" and accordingly the Government has also passed orders, bringing him to regular time scale of pay with effect from 23.06.2006 and he is continuing his services as on date.
5. The learned Counsels appearing for these petitioners 3, 4 and 5 would submit that they are willing to be absorbed as "Sweepers" and brought under regular time scale of pay with effect from 23.06.2006 onwards.
6. In light of the above observations, the following directions are issued, (i)The 1st respondent shall take a final decision and pass appropriate orders in connection with the proposal sent by the Coimbatore Corporation on 01.02.2021 in connection with the 1st petitioner namely, K.M.Duraisamy son of Mallaiyan, within a period of eight (08) we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
(ii)The 1st respondent herein shall pass appropriate orders regularizing the services of the petitioners 3 and 4 namely A.Subramanian, son of Alagirisamy; and P.Muruganathan, son of Pitchaimuthu respectively in the post of "Sweeper" with effect from 23.06.2006 onwards and bring them under regular time scale of pay, within a period of eight (08) we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
(iii)The 1st respondent shall pass appropriate orders to extend the monetary benefits with effect from 23.06.2006 and disburse the same to the petitioners 3 and 4 atleast within a period of 8 we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. (iv)The claim of the 2nd petitioner is hereby rejected. (v)The claim of the 5th petitioner has become infructuous, since he has already been regularised and brought under regular time scale of pay and in case the arrears of the salaries have not
been disbursed to the 5th petitioner, the same shall be done by the 1st respondent herein within a period of 8 we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. This Writ Petition stands ordered, accordingly. No costs.
